Floral Collage
I used a candle as a wax resist, watercolour paints and recycled stationery for the collaged yellow flowers.

Patterns and Motifs
These are my version of drawings found in The Encyclopedia of Patterns and Motifs - these being Peruvian textiles. And these are some with various alterations.
I drew a picture of an onion being chopped and a watery eye for an illustration Friday contest, the word strong I think, but I didn't like it so I didn't enter it. I've since done a paint job on the top. I used a hand made stamp to make marks and painted over when dry. I used brusho inks and it could be used as a background page now.
